Jayanti Sarovar, commonly known as the Jubilee Park Lake, is a magnificent man-made water body that acts as the centerpiece of the sprawling Jubilee Park in Jamshedpur. This beautiful lake was inaugurated in 1956 as part of the Jubilee Park complex, which itself was a grand gift to the citizens of J amshedpur by Tata Steel on the occasion of the company's 50th anniversary. The park and lake were conceived to be a world-class recreational space, inspired by the majestic Brindavan Gardens of Mysore and the classic Mughal Gardens. The lake's calm waters, surrounded by lush, well-maintained gardens and tree-lined pathways, offer a perfect escape from the industrial city's bustle. It is particularly famed for its stunning illuminated fountains that create a picturesque spectacle every evening, especially around the time of the Founder's Day celebrations in March. Visitors flock here for peaceful morning walks, jogging, family picnics, and, most notably, for the relaxing boat rides available on its surface. During the cooler winter months (October to March), the lake's environment becomes a temporary home for several species of migratory birds, transforming it into a minor birdwatcher's paradise. The serene atmosphere, combined with its central location, makes it an iconic and beloved landmark for both locals and tourists visiting the city. Its proximity to other major attractions, like the Tata Steel Zoological Park, makes it a cornerstone of Jamshedpur's tourism circuit, symbolizing the city's blend of industrial progress and natural beauty. How to Reach

Reaching Jamshedpur (The Gateway):

By Air: The nearest airport is Birsa Munda Airport (IXR) in Ranchi, which is about 120 KMS away and well-connected to major Indian cities like Delhi, Mumbai, and Kolkata. From Ranchi, you can hire a pre-paid taxi, use a shared cab, or take a bus directly to Jamshedpur (a 3-4 hour journey). The local Sonari Airport (IXW) in Jamshedpur handles chartered flights only.

By Train: The most convenient way to reach is by train to Tatanagar Junction (TATA). This is a major railway hub and is exceptionally well-connected to virtually all parts of India, including Kolkata, Mumbai, Chennai, and New Delhi, via numerous express and superfast trains.

By Road: Jamshedpur has excellent road connectivity. National Highways connect it to major cities. Regular and comfortable bus services (both government and private) run to and from Ranchi, Kolkata, Bhubaneswar, and other nearby towns. You can also drive easily via NH-33.

Reaching Jayanti Sarovar (Local Transport):

From Tatanagar Junction: The railway station is approximately 5 KMS from the sarovar. You can easily hire auto-rickshaws, cycle-rickshaws, or app-based cabs (like Uber or Ola) for a quick and inexpensive ride directly to the main gate of Jubilee Park/Sarovar.

From City Center (Bistupur/Sakchi): The sarovar is centrally located and is a short ride (about 10-15 minutes) from the main market areas. Auto-rickshaws are the most common and accessible form of local transport. They operate on a shared or reserved basis. Local Buses also ply routes near the park's main entrances. The entire park area is well-known, so simply stating "Jubilee Park" or "Jayanti Sarovar" will suffice for any local driver.
